Expanding and standardising electronic invoicing
Public contracting authorities will be required to receive electronic invoices that comply with the European standard. In addition, businesses and contracting authorities will be entitled to require their invoices in electronic format from other organisations.

Renewing US defence procurement agreement
Finland and the United States will renew their agreement on reciprocal defence procurement for ten years. The agreement will facilitate the procurement of defence materiel and promote exports by the Finnish defence industry to the United States.

Extending tax rules for life-cycle projects
Tax and accrual rules for projects carried out under the life-cycle model will expand from state road projects to municipal and corporate construction projects, such as schools and hospitals. Under the amendment, project income, expenses and value added tax (VAT) will be accrued evenly across the entire contract period based on the use of the property.

Reforming public procurement rules
Rules on competitive tendering in public procurement will be reformed and procedures streamlined by making them more flexible and electronic. Participation in competitive tendering by small businesses will be made easier and the supervision of procurement will be enhanced.

Energy efficiency requirements for government procurement
Central government authorities will be required to procure only energy-efficient products, services and buildings. The requirement applies to public procurement exceeding the EU thresholds.
